How they compare
Pre-demographic dividend currently reports 71.94 million hectares against 10.33 million hectares in Niger, a difference of 61.61 million hectares.
That makes Pre-demographic dividend's figure about 7.0 times Niger's.
Across all 64 years both countries report, Pre-demographic dividend has been ahead every year.
Niger ranks 19th and Pre-demographic dividend ranks 20th of 181 countries.
Pre-demographic dividend has averaged higher in every one of the 7 decades both report.

About this data
Land under cereal production refers to harvested area, although some countries report only sown or cultivated area. Cereals include wheat, rice, maize, barley, oats, rye, millet, sorghum, buckwheat, and mixed grains. Production data on cereals relate to crops harvested for dry grain only. Cereal crops harvested for hay or harvested green for food, feed, or silage and those used for grazing are excluded.
